qapi: Make doc comments optional where we don't need them
Since we added the documentation generator in commit 3313b61, doc
comments are mandatory.  That's a very good idea for a schema that
needs to be documented, but has proven to be annoying for testing.

Make doc comments optional again, but add a new directive

    { 'pragma': { 'doc-required': true } }

to let a QAPI schema require them.

Add test cases for the new pragma directive.  While there, plug a
minor hole in includ directive test coverage.

Require documentation in the schemas we actually want documented:
qapi-schema.json and qga/qapi-schema.json.

We could probably make qapi2texi.py cope with incomplete
documentation, but for now, simply make it refuse to run unless the
schema has 'doc-required': true.
